Our Dobermans are raised with the finest of foods, Purina Pro Plan Large Breed Puppy, climate, play time, and socialization possible.  Once puppies are born they live, with their mother, in our birthing room connected to our kitchen.  As soon as they can walk they are given the run of their room and the kitchen to play with their toys and the other adult animals.  Socialization is a top priority to ensure these puppies will successfully blend into your home and be ready for what you have to offer.  As the puppies are weaned from the mother crate training begins.  Another Mother will step in to keep order within the litter.  We have found this to be a successful tactic because of the adult guidance.

At five weeks of age the shots are started to insure they are protected from the evils of disease,  Also, during week #5 the puppies will get their litter tattoo.  In this case the Litter Letter is "J" and the number of your individual dog.  Please call for any additional information.
